Navi Mumbai: In Kharghar, Navi Mumbai, the CBI has arrested Krishna Kumar, a senior Customs officer, for allegedly accepting a bribe of Rs 10.2 lakh. Kumar, who served as superintendent at Sahar Air Cargo, was apprehended after evading the CBI for about an hour. He reportedly had established a 'rate card' for clearing goods and, leveraging his connections with the R&I wing of the Customs, had been halting shipments until he received compensation.

After stalling a firm's goods, Kumar sent an anonymous email demanding a bribe to release the shipments, claiming that most of the bribe would be shared with senior officials. Following his arrest, he was placed in CBI custody until 6 August for further investigation into the R&I wing's involvement in the case.

The CBI's investigation stemmed from complaints alleging that Kumar and other unnamed officers were soliciting bribes at a rate of Rs 10 per kilogram of imported goods, despite the legality of the cargo. One firm owner, pressured by Kumar, sought assistance from the CBI after his goods were deliberately withheld despite having all necessary documents.

Reel Chase Scene In Real Life

The CBI set up a trap, recording conversations between 25 July and 1 August, revealing Kumar's demands for bribes amounting to Rs 6 lakh for previously cleared goods and Rs 10 lakh for current imports. During this time, he stated that he would only retain Rs 20,000 from the bribe, with the remainder destined for his superiors.

On the day of the arrest, Kumar met the complainant outside his colony, accepted the bribe in his vehicle, and attempted to evade capture by speeding through the area. However, he grew suspicious, discarded a bag containing the money near a dustbin, and was subsequently apprehended by CBI officers, leading to a scene of public commotion. The investigation now focuses on Kumar and the involvement of other Customs officials in this bribery scheme.
